【前端和后端哪个工资高】在IT行业,前端开发和后端开发是两个非常重要的技术方向。很多人在选择职业道路时,都会关心“前端和后端哪个工资高”这个问题。其实,这两个岗位的薪资水平受多种因素影响,包括地区、公司规模、个人能力、技术栈等。下面我们将从多个角度进行分析,并通过表格形式直观展示两者的差异。
一、总体情况总结
从整体趋势来看,后端开发的平均薪资普遍略高于前端开发,尤其是在大型企业或互联网公司中,后端工程师的薪资待遇通常更优。不过,这并不意味着前端没有高薪机会。随着前端技术的发展(如React、Vue、TypeScript等),前端工程师的薪资也在逐年上升,特别是在一些技术驱动型公司中,前端岗位的竞争力越来越强。
此外,不同地区的薪资水平也有较大差异。一线城市如北京、上海、深圳的薪资普遍高于二三线城市,但生活成本也更高。
二、薪资对比(以2024年数据为参考)
维度 | 前端开发 | 后端开发 |
平均月薪 | 15K - 25K 元 | 18K - 30K 元 |
高级工程师 | 25K - 40K 元 | 30K - 50K 元 |
技术要求 | HTML/CSS/JavaScript、框架、UI/UX | Java/Python/Go、数据库、架构设计 |
职业发展路径 | UI/UX、全栈、架构师 | 架构师、技术总监、CTO |
工作压力 | 中等,偏重界面与交互 | 较高,涉及系统稳定性与性能 |
就业机会 | 广泛,适合初学者 | 稍具门槛,需较强逻辑思维 |
三、影响薪资的关键因素
1. 技术栈与语言选择
- 前端:React、Vue、Angular、TypeScript等。
- 后端:Java、Python、Node.js、Go、PHP等。
- 不同语言在市场上的需求和薪资水平有差异。
2. 项目复杂度与团队规模
- 大型项目或高并发系统对后端的要求更高,因此后端工程师的薪酬往往更具竞争力。
3. 公司类型
- 互联网大厂、科技公司通常提供更高的薪资。
- 传统企业或中小型公司可能薪资相对较低。
4. 个人能力与经验
- 有丰富项目经验、能独立负责模块甚至系统的开发者,薪资普遍更高。
四、结语
“前端和后端哪个工资高”并没有一个绝对的答案。两者各有优势,薪资差距主要取决于技术深度、项目难度、公司背景和个人能力。如果你对用户交互感兴趣,前端是一个不错的选择;如果你喜欢系统设计和逻辑推理,后端可能更适合你。最终,选择哪个方向,还是要结合自己的兴趣和长期职业规划来决定。
注:以上数据为2024年部分互联网公司及招聘平台的综合参考,具体薪资以实际岗位为准。